Artan Karini
Position: Assistant Professor
Education Background: Ph.D. in Development Policy and Management, University of Manchester (UK)
Dr Artan Karini specializes in comparative public management and reform, international HRM, global governance institutions and development aid effectiveness. His 20 years’ experience as academic, researcher and senior academic advisor has spanned across Europe, North America and MENA/GCC. He is a former Fulbright scholar and has published in several reputable international journals through publishers including Springer, Routledge, Palgrave Mcmillan, MDPI and Wiley. In addition to his formal training as an academic, he holds a professional designation in Advanced HR from Queen’s University (Canada).
Prior to joining the Graduate School of Public Policy (GSPP) at Nazabayev University, he served as Adjunct Research Professor at the Institute of European, Russian and Eurasian Studies, Carleton University (Canada), Assistant Professor and MPA Director at the American University in Cairo (AUC) as well as, more recently, faculty member at a private university in northern Oman. Dr. Karini currently teaches courses in Public Management and Leadership (MPP 641) and Development Assistance in Governance (MPE 673).
